PARTNERSHIP WITH MEMORANDUM
27.07.2011

Representatives of civil society, who accepted invitation of City Municipality of Palilula on cooperation in realization of joint projects and the realization of the Strategy of Development of Municipality, signed a MEMORANDUM OF COOPERATION. In this way, the NGO sector and Palilula Municipality, as one of organization of local self government of City of Nis, will work to achieve development concept under the motto “PARTNERSHIP FOR MODERN PALILULA”. Contracts signed with representatives of 33 organizations of civil society, under the authority of the President of Municipality, Boban Mikic, member of Municipal Council and in the name of NGO organization, expressed gratitude to the organizer of the conference transferred Jelena Golubov – Todorovic.

In orde to improve the quality of life of citizens and better cooperation with organization of civil society, administrations and institutions of the City, on the making of the project of interests for local community in 2011/2012, management of City Municipality of Palilula in the first half of this year organized several work meetings and panel discussions with representatives of interested associations and organizations in the city. The aim of talks was to observe the activities in one place and the possibility of establishing a dialogue of local authorities and NGOs in the European integration processes and program activities of City Municipality of Palilula. Project ideas were exchanged, views of local and regional development, discussed possibilities of cooperation between public and NGO sector in the accession process to EU, the improvement of project activities.

According to Boban Mikic, member of Council of CM Palilula, who, on behalf of the President Prof. Dr Igor Novakovic signed the Memorandum, after months of consultation meetings with organizations of civil society was agreed that the next step be signing the Memorandum of Cooperation. This act effectively we opened a new stage in cooperation and achieving partnership of local authorities and NGOs.
